Cicero Prep Academy saw some tournament action on Monday. They were the clear victor by a 46-24 margin over the Metro Tech Knights.
Cicero Prep Academy was led to victory by Chelsea Leggat and Ryleigh Weaver. Leggat almost dropped a double-double on 13 points and nine rebounds, while Weaver posted 12 points along with three steals. Leggat is also crushing it when it comes to steals: she's grabbed at least two every time she's taken the court this season. Another player making a difference was Catherine Johnson, who posted four points plus six rebounds.
Cicero Prep Academy smashed the offensive glass and finished the game with 17 offensive rebounds. That strong performance was nothing new for the team: they've now pulled down at least ten offensive rebounds in three consecutive contests.
Several Knights players turned in solid performances despite ultimately coming up short. Perhaps the best among those players was Dianely Granados, who scored four points in addition to 11 rebounds.
Cicero Prep Academy now has a winning record of 2-1. As for Metro Tech, their loss dropped their record down to 0-2.
Cicero Prep Academy has already played their next matchup, a 40-27 victory against Coronado on the 26th. As for Metro Tech, they also didn't take long to hit the court again: they've already played their next game, a 39-27 win against La Joya Community on the 26th.
